What the SAMHSA Record Shows About Pathways Center Care Campus

Pathways Center Care Campus is a substance use treatment operated by Private non-profit organization in Newnan, Georgia. The facility's N-SUMHSS record lists 4 primary care modalities (residential, outpatient, detox, telehealth), which shapes both how treatment is delivered and how intake is scheduled. MAT is not listed in the current record; callers seeking medication-assisted options should verify directly or check the rankings pages for nearby providers that do offer MAT. The full postal address on file is 78 Hospital Road, Newnan, GA 30263.

On the services side, the facility self-reports 11 distinct service lines (Co-occurring disorder treatment, Cognitive behavioral therapy, Detoxification, Hospital inpatient, Mental health services, Motivational interviewing, Outpatient, Substance use treatment, Suicide prevention services, Telehealth, and 1 more), 1 substance or condition category treated (General substance use disorders), and 10 clinical treatment approaches (Anger management, Brief intervention, Cognitive behavioral therapy, Contingency management/motivational incentives, Matrix Model, Motivational interviewing, Relapse prevention, Substance use disorder counseling, Telemedicine/telehealth therapy, Trauma-related counseling). It serves 2 specific population groups (Adolescents, Persons with co-occurring disorders) with 1 language of care (Sign language services for the deaf and hard of hearing). Those figures give a rough signal of programmatic breadth, a higher number of approaches and populations usually indicates more structured clinical programming rather than a single-modality operation. Payment-wise, the record confirms Medicaid, private insurance, a sliding-fee scale, payment assistance, plus 4 specific payment methods enumerated in the survey (Federal, or any government funding for substance use treatment programs, Medicaid, Private health insurance, State-financed health insurance plan other than Medicaid).

Pathways Center Care Campus reports 30 attributes across services, populations, payment, and language, in line with the Georgia statewide median of 34 (325 facilities listed).
